The Fountainhead (1949) is King Vidor's drama you can watch online on iFILM. Architect Howard Roark builds the way he believes is right and refuses to bend his blueprints to anyone else's taste, even when that stubbornness costs him his entire career.

Clients want columns and familiar grandeur; Roark hands them bare concrete and the sharp lines of the future. He would rather lose every commission and break rock in a granite quarry than surrender one detail. That is where Dominique Francon finds him — a columnist who falls for the very rigidity that may destroy him. Circling the story are newspaper baron Gail Wynand and a critic determined to grind Roark into dust. The hero's courtroom speech at the climax has long been quoted on its own.

Gary Cooper plays Roark, with Patricia Neal and Raymond Massey beside him. Ayn Rand adapted the screenplay from her own novel, and the film plays like a blunt manifesto: the individual against the crowd, no compromise, no shades of grey.
